Reading Time: 2 minutes Introduction to Idiopathic Short Stature Idiopathic Short Stature (ISS) is a condition characterized by a height significantly below average for age and gender, without an identifiable cause. In the United States, this condition affects a notable percentage of the male population, often leading to psychological and social challenges. The quest for effective treatment options has led to the exploration of growth hormone therapies, among which Omnitrope has emerged as a significant contender.
